The state support of industry products export in modern economy: peculiarities of taken measures

D. N. Sirtcov () and O. N. Syrtsova ()

Russian Journal of Industrial Economics, 2016, issue 4

Abstract: The article describes the principle theoretical aspects of the international exchange. It is shown that the development of the world economy leads to a permanent transformation of foreign trade activities: the international cooperation, the monetary, financial and other relationships change, new forms appear. Particularly acute is the question of the role of the state in the industrial exports support. The authors analyze the features of the world experience of export support and show that the current challenges of the global economy often force the state to support the exports in order to strengthen the role of national companies in international exchange. The performed analysis shows that , despite the liberalization of modern trade and increased freedom of companies performing the foreign economic activity, the state has still to regulate trade relations and apply measures to support the export.
